Exploring the Therapeutic Benefits of Music for Women's Health
Menopause symptoms can be challenging for many women, both physically and emotionally. Research suggests that music therapy can offer several benefits in alleviating these symptoms and promoting overall well-being during this transitional phase of life.
How Music Can Help Alleviate Menopause Symptoms:
Reduction of stress and anxiety levels
Improvement in mood and emotional well-being
Enhancement of quality of sleep
Boost in cognitive function and memory
Relief from physical discomfort and pain
By incorporating music into daily routines, women experiencing menopause can potentially find relief from various symptoms and improve their overall quality of life.
